IC Electricals Company Limited is engaged in providing advanced engineering solutions to Indian Railways. The company offers a range of electronic products, including regulators, battery chargers, emergency lights, inverters, microprocessor-based control systems and vigilance control devices that comply with the latest technical standards.  

It also manufactures railway components such as alternators, traction motors and permanent magnet alternators with controllers. In addition, the company executes turnkey railway electrification projects involving the design, supply, erection, testing and commissioning of 25 kV AC overhead equipment and traction substation systems.

IC Electricals operates within India's railway electrical and electronic equipment industry, a sector supported by ongoing investments in railway modernisation, electrification and network expansion. The company provides advanced engineering solutions and a broad range of electronic products for Indian Railways, including regulators, battery chargers, inverters, control systems, traction motors and alternators. It also undertakes turnkey railway electrification projects involving the design, supply, erection, testing and commissioning of 25 kV AC overhead equipment and traction substation systems. 

India's railway infrastructure development continues to create opportunities for companies operating in this segment. The government's focus on expanding electrified rail routes, increasing operational efficiency and deploying modern train systems such as Vande Bharat trains is expected to support demand for railway electrical equipment and related engineering services. The target of achieving complete broad-gauge route electrification and continued investments in railway infrastructure could provide long-term growth opportunities for specialised players such as IC Electricals.
